4000000000
您的位置:首页>>快连测速>>正文

全国免费服务热线

4000000000

自建VPN服务器,解锁网络自由与安全新境界

时间:2024-11-15 作者:南风 点击:1次

信息摘要:

打造专属自制VPN服务器,轻松实现网络自由与安全。仅需简单设置,即可搭建个人专属服务器,突破地域限制,保障隐私数据安全,畅享全球网络资源。轻松一步,开启网络自由新境界。...

打造专属自制VPN服务器,轻松实现网络自由与安全。仅需简单设置,即可搭建个人专属服务器,突破地域限制,保障隐私数据安全,畅享全球网络资源。轻松一步,开启网络自由新境界。
  1. 打造个人VPN服务器的优势
  2. 个人VPN服务器的搭建指南

自建VPN服务器,解锁网络自由与安全新境界,VPN示意图,自制vpn服务器,VPN服,VPN的,定制VPN,第1张

互联网的广泛渗透,使得网络已成为我们日常生活不可或缺的一部分,在我国,由于网络监管政策的限制,一些网站和资源难以直接访问,为应对这一挑战,众多用户转而使用VPN(虚拟私人网络)服务,VPN能突破地域限制,保障网络自由与安全,如何构建一个专属于自己的VPN服务器呢?本文将为您深入剖析这一过程。

打造个人VPN服务器的优势

1. **自主掌控**:拥有自建的VPN服务器,您将享有完全的使用自主权,不受第三方服务提供商的限制。

2. **增强安全**:自建服务器能更有效地管理数据传输,降低数据被第三方窃取的风险。

3. **经济实惠**:与购买商业VPN服务相比,自建服务器可以显著降低成本。

4. **定制化需求**:可根据个人需求定制VPN服务器,实现个性化的使用体验。

个人VPN服务器的搭建指南

1. **准备工作

  • 服务器选择:您可以选择云服务器或物理服务器,根据实际需求选择合适的配置。
  • 操作系统:推荐使用Linux系统,如Ubuntu、CentOS等。
  • 域名注册:注册一个域名,便于用户访问您的VPN服务器。

2. **安装服务器软件

  • 远程登录:使用SSH工具连接到服务器。
  • 更新系统:运行以下命令以更新系统软件包。
  • sudo apt-get update

    sudo apt-get upgrade
  • 安装OpenVPN:运行以下命令安装OpenVPN。
  • sudo apt-get install openvpn

3. **配置OpenVPN

  • 创建用户:运行以下命令创建用于运行OpenVPN的用户。
  • sudo adduser openvpnuser
  • 生成CA证书:运行以下命令生成CA证书。
  • sudo openvpn --genkey --secret ca.key
  • 生成服务器证书和私钥:运行以下命令生成服务器证书和私钥。
  • sudo openvpn --req --days 3650 --utf8-name "CN=server" --config /etc/openvpn/server.cnf --key server.key --cert server.crt
  • 生成客户端证书和私钥:运行以下命令生成客户端证书和私钥。
  • sudo openvpn --genkey --secret client.key

    sudo openvpn --req --days 3650 --utf8-name "CN=client" --config /etc/openvpn/client.cnf --key client.key --cert client.crt
  • 创建配置文件:将以下内容保存为/etc/openvpn/server.conf
  • port 1194

    proto udp

    dev tun

    ca ca.crt

    cert server.crt

    key server.key

    dh dh2048.pem

    server 10.8.0.0 255.255.255.0

    ifconfig-pool-persist ipp.txt

    push "redirect-gateway def1"

    push "dhcp-option DNS 8.8.8.8"

    keepalive 10 120

    tls-auth ta.key 0

    comp-lzo

    user openvpnuser

    group openvpnuser

    persist-key

    persist-tun

    status openvpn-status.log

    log-openvpn.log
  • 创建DH参数文件:运行以下命令生成DH参数文件。
  • sudo openvpn --genkey --secret dh2048.pem

4. **启动OpenVPN服务

  • 设置开机自启:运行以下命令使OpenVPN服务开机自启。
  • sudo systemctl enable openvpn@server
  • 启动服务:运行以下命令启动OpenVPN服务。
  • sudo systemctl start openvpn@server

5. **配置客户端连接

  • 导入证书:将客户端证书和私钥导入到OpenVPN客户端软件。
  • 配置参数:设置服务器地址、端口、CA证书等连接参数。
  • 连接服务器:完成以上步骤后,即可连接到VPN服务器。

通过上述步骤,您已成功搭建起个人VPN服务器,使用自建的VPN服务器,您将享受到网络自由与安全,但请注意,在使用VPN时,务必遵守我国相关法律法规,切勿用于非法用途,随着技术的进步,VPN服务器的搭建和配置可能会变得越来越复杂,如遇难题,建议查阅相关资料或寻求专业人士的帮助,祝您搭建顺利!

请先 登录 再评论,若不是会员请先 注册